Output 8fdfb4e2c5f94eba7765ecf756d18c55dd3fc171ccc965cf5c53ffdc478b3342:1

value
99966613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f52c637e4fc676f22ea324319fca840d16d2416 OP_EQUAL
address
3LbExWbqbVhK8Nn5cSe1mFWedScTATQFFx
transaction
8fdfb4e2c5f94eba7765ecf756d18c55dd3fc171ccc965cf5c53ffdc478b3342
spent
true